On the centennial of the National Park Service, this richly illustrated book offers invaluable advice on exploring America’s national park system.
The book delves into issues affecting an array of parks: the iconic western national parks like Yellowstone; the urban parks such as Golden Gate National Recreation Area; historic sites including the Statue of Liberty National Monument and Gettysburg National Military Park; and cultural areas like Mesa Verde National Park that are among America’s over 400 national parks.

About the Authors:
Robert E. Manning, Ph.D., is Steven Rubenstein Professor of Environment and Natural Resources at University of Vermont
Rolf Diamant is a former national park superintendent and is now adjunct associate professor at the University of Vermont
Nora J. Mitchell, Ph.D. is former Director, National Park Service Stewardship Institute and is now adjunct associate professor at the University of Vermont
David Harmon is executive director of the George Wright Society.
